    Learn more about Econometrics Certificate programs

    Studying econometrics at the Certificates level offers a focused approach to understanding economic data and quantitative methods. This program is ideal for those interested in harnessing statistical tools to inform economic decisions and policies.

    Through courses in econometric analysis, predictive modeling, and statistical inference, you'll build critical skills necessary for data interpretation and economic forecasting. Students strengthen their analytical abilities while engaging with complex datasets, laying the groundwork for effective decision-making. Exposure to real-world economic problems ensures that learners can apply their knowledge practically, enhancing their readiness for the job market.

    The curriculum typically includes modules that cover regression analysis, time series analysis, and data visualization. Graduates emerge with a solid foundation in crafting economic narratives from data, equipping them for roles in finance, government, or research sectors. Completing a certificate in econometrics not only boosts employability but also sharpens your ability to contribute to data-driven discussions in various economic contexts.
